Ruthenium catalyzed biomimetic oxidation in organic synthesis inspired by cytochrome P-450
Abstract
Simulation of the function of cytochrome P-450 with low valent ruthenium complex catalysts leads to the discovery of biomimetic, catalytic oxidation of various substrates selectively under mild conditions. The reactions discussed in this tutorial review are simple, clean, and practical. The principle of these reactions is fundamental and gives wide-scope and environmentally benign future practical methods.
